Tariff Rates Effective June 1, 2010
Effective June 1, 2010 the Water Authority adopted a proposal to increase rates 7.24%.
|
|
|
| Metered Residential & Commercial (Quarterly Charges) |
Minimum Charge (Including 9,000 gallons = 100 gallons per day) *Rates are based on a 90 day period. |
|
All Meter Sizes |
$30.71 |
| Usage Rates (per 1000 gallons) |
|
Block 1 (Next 96,000 gal. over of min.) |
$2.954 |
|
Block 2 (All usage over 105,000 gal.) |
$2.027 |

The following is a summary of rate changes since the Water Authority's inception:
| Date |
Rate Increase / (Decrease)
|
|
June 01, 2010 |
7.24% |
| June 01, 2009 |
7.40% |
June 01, 2008
|
7.80% |
| June 01, 2007 |
7.13% |
| June 01, 2006 |
7.60%
|
| June 01, 2005 |
3.80%
|
June 01, 2001 TO June 01, 2004 |
NO CHANGE
|
| June 01, 2000 |
(4.5%)
|
| June 01, 1999 |
(9.8%)
|
| June 01, 1998 |
(17.7%)
|
| June 01, 1997 |
(22.2%)
|
| June 01, 1996 |
(11.5%)
|
In addition, the Water Authority passed back earnings credits of $560,000 in fiscal year 1999 - 2000 and $1.8 million (19.8% of average bill) in fiscal year 2000 - 2001.
